What symptoms to describe when requesting resurfacing in Julian

Note which symptoms from the list below apply, when each started, and whether it's getting worse.

Pebble finish shedding stones
the bond between aggregate and substrate has failed, and patching it rarely holds.
Waterline tile falling off
movement at the bond beam or failed thinset, and it is worth diagnosing before it becomes a resurface.
Grey or mottled staining that will not brush out
usually mineral deposit or spot etching, and it tells you the water chemistry that caused it.
Cracks in the shell
shrinkage cracks are cosmetic, structural cracks are not, and they are told apart by pattern and depth.

What are general US planning prices for plaster, quartz, and pebble resurfacing?

HomeGuide (April 25, 2025) lists general US planning ranges, resurfacing-only and excluding refill, of about $6-$8 per square foot for plaster, $7-$10 for quartz plaster, and $7-$15 for pebble. How does elevation affect pool repair needs in Julian?

Freeze protection is the biggest factor. At 4,000-plus feet, winter temperatures routinely drop low enough to crack unprotected pipes and damage equipment that was never properly winterized. Well water through Private wells (Julian CSD) or a private well also runs hard, adding scale buildup to the mix. Pool repair pros in the network assess both freeze damage and mineral scale when diagnosing an issue up here.

What should I do if my Julian pool wasn't winterized properly?

Have it inspected before running the system. A pool that went through freezing temperatures without proper winterization can have hairline cracks in plumbing or a cracked pump housing that won't show symptoms until you try to start it back up.
